Gohain hardsells Modi's achievements
Source: The Sangai Express
Imphal, February 23 2017:
In his efforts to woo the voters of Manipur, Union Minister of State for Railways Rajen Gohain highlighted various achievements of Prime Minister Narendra Modi.
Even though it has been just about two years and a half since Narendra Modi became the Prime Minister of India, corruption has become a thing of the past, claimed Rajen Gohain.
He was speaking at a flag hoisting ceremony of BJP candidate in Thongju AC Thongam Biswajit held today at the latter's Ningomthong residence.
He went on to assert that Prime Minister Narendra Modi has delivered good governance across the country.
On the other hand, the Congress Government of Manipur did nothing beneficial for the people during the past 15 years except fomenting communal hatred and indulging in corruption.
He also accused the Congress Govt of misleading the masses regarding the Framework Agreement.
While they themselves are unable to clear or get the economic blockade lifted, the Congress Government has been blaming the Central Government.
After the Look East Policy has been transformed as Act East Policy, the Central Government has been working to develop Moreh and Imphal as highly strategic business centres.
He went to exude confidence that BJP would score a landslide victory in the ensuing election and certainly form the next Government.
He then appealed to the people of Thongju AC to support Biswajit in the ensuing election.
BJP Manipur Pradesh president K Bhabananda, former Chief Minister Radhabinod Koijam, BJP Manipur Pradesh former president M Bhorot, former Minister S Brajagopal Sharma and BJP Vision Document convenor Dr RK Ranjan were also present at the flag hoisting ceremony.
